How to fill out community information amp assistance:

01
Start by gathering all relevant information about the community that you wish to provide assistance to. This can include demographic data, community needs assessments, and any existing programs or services available.
02
Create a comprehensive form or questionnaire that captures all the necessary information. Ensure that the form is user-friendly and easy to understand, with clear instructions on how to fill it out.
03
Begin the form by asking for basic contact information, such as name, address, phone number, and email address. This will help you communicate with the individuals seeking assistance and keep them updated on any developments.
04
Move on to gathering specific details about the assistance needed. Ask questions such as the type of support required (financial, housing, education, healthcare, etc.), the reason for seeking assistance, and any relevant documentation or proof of need.
05
Include a section where individuals can provide additional comments or information that may be pertinent to their request. This can help you understand their situation better and provide more targeted assistance.
06
Ensure that the form has clear instructions on where to submit it once completed. Provide multiple options such as email, mail, or in-person drop-off, depending on what is most convenient for the individuals seeking assistance.
07
Make sure to keep the information provided confidential and secure. Only share it with relevant community organizations or service providers who can effectively address the needs outlined in the form.
08
Regularly review and update the form based on feedback and changing community needs.

Who needs community information amp assistance?

01
Individuals facing financial hardships who require support to meet their basic needs.
02
Minorities or marginalized communities who may face systemic barriers and require assistance to access resources and services.
03
Victims of natural disasters or emergencies who need immediate help with shelter, food, and other essential needs.
04
Individuals with physical or mental disabilities who require specialized support and assistance programs.
05
Elderly individuals who may need assistance with healthcare, housing, or social services.
06
Immigrants, refugees, or newcomers who need help navigating the local community and finding resources.
07
Community organizations or nonprofits that provide support to vulnerable populations and can benefit from community information and assistance.
08
Any individual or family struggling to overcome poverty, addiction, or other hardships and seeking a helping hand from their community.
